The digital transformation of energy operations has accelerated across the United States, driven by rising operational costs and demands for greater precision. In oilfield and gas processing, managing solid control—separating unwanted particles from flowback fluid—is a key challenge. Traditional systems often struggle with consistency, slow response times, and hidden inefficiencies. How Odessa’s Solids Control Game-Changer Actually Works

At its core, Odessa’s Solids Control Game-Changer leverages intelligent software paired with modular hardware designed for seamless integration into existing workflows. Unlike legacy systems that require major infrastructure overhauls, this solution delivers incremental improvements through optimized data pipelines. By analyzing flow rates, particle concentrations, and process variables in real time, the platform identifies inefficiencies before they escalate into operational bottlenecks. This proactive management reduces manual intervention, lowers error rates, and supports faster decision-making. For operators handling increasing volumes or complex fluids, this stability translates directly into fewer process halts and improved throughput.
